The Instituto Politécnico Nacional (IPN), through the National Science and Technology Library "Víctor Bravo Ahuja" and the Central Library "Salvador Magaña Garduño," has signed a collaboration agreement for interlibrary loans with the Universidad Rosario Castellanos (URC). This agreement will benefit the educational communities of both institutions.
The collection of the two major IPN libraries comprises 182,255 volumes that cater to the needs of students enrolled in academic programs in the fields of Engineering and Physical-Mathematical Sciences, Medical-Biological Sciences, Social and Administrative Sciences, and Interdisciplinary Studies.
In signing the agreement, the Director General of IPN noted that libraries have been indispensable in every culture where they have flourished, extending beyond cultural aspects to include innovation, science, and technology. Therefore, he asserted, this agreement aims to disseminate this knowledge and provide students with access to bibliographic resources not available in all libraries.
The IPN head highlighted the importance of institutional collaboration, particularly in promoting and consolidating spaces that encourage reading, to develop “responsible citizens through students and future graduates who seek progress, respect, peace, and friendship among all human beings.”
Through this agreement, he added, we also strengthen library networks to benefit student, academic, and scientific communities, while contributing to the enhancement of the teaching-learning process.
The Director of the Universidad Rosario Castellanos (URC) emphasized the support that the Instituto Politécnico Nacional has provided to the institution, especially in the development of three programs offered in its classrooms, such as Control and Automation Engineering and the bachelor's degrees in Tourism and Psychology, which already have graduated.
The Politécnico, the director elaborated, “nurtures and enriches us, and we also aim to contribute the resources we have developed over the past five years.”
